After days of silence, Taylor Swift has finally spoken out about the failed terrorist attack targeting her "Eras Tour" performances in Vienna, Austria.

August 21st, Taylor Swift The attack was mentioned for the first time. terrorism failure and the cancellation of three concerts in Vienna on the billion-dollar tour. Eras Tour .

“The cancellation of our Vienna shows is incredibly painful. The reason for the cancellation is frightening and I feel incredibly guilty because so many people had planned to see those shows. But I am also very grateful to the authorities because, thanks to them, we are only grieving for the concerts, not for lives. I am delighted by the love and solidarity I see from the fans who stand together. I have decided to put all my energy into helping protect the nearly half a million people I attended the London show. My team and I have been working directly with stadium staff and the British authorities every day to pursue that goal. I want to thank them for everything they have done for us,” Taylor wrote in a post summarizing her European tour on Instagram.

Beauty She explained that her silence was due to the possibility of inciting those who wanted to harm fans attending her show.

Taylor emphasized that silence represented restraint and waiting to express herself at the right time. She prioritized safely concluding her European tour and felt relieved that everything went according to plan.

Concluding her heartfelt message, Taylor expressed her gratitude to her London fans: “London was like a series of beautiful dreams. All the crowds at the five shows at Wembley Stadium were bursting with passion, joy, and excitement. The energy in that stadium was like the biggest hug of 92,000 people each night, and it brought me back to a place of peace and carefree joy.”

Earlier, Taylor Swift was forced to cancel three nights of her concerts at Austria's Ernst Happel Stadium from August 8-10 at the last minute. Organizer Barracuda Music stated that the decision was made after authorities discovered a suicide bombing plot targeting fans outside the concert venue.

Franz Ruf, director general for public safety at the Austrian Interior Ministry , said authorities had successfully thwarted a terrorist plot and arrested three teenagers aged 15-19. The suspects all pledged allegiance to the leader of the self-proclaimed Islamic State (IS).

Many fans expressed disappointment that Taylor Swift hadn't commented on the incident. The criticism intensified when she was spotted hosting a party for 200 staff members at a luxury club in London on August 12-13. Fans were outraged that the star had time to party until 3 am but couldn't even write a single word of encouragement to her fans in Vienna on social media.

The singer's latest move Anti-hero This helped to appease angry fans. The post received over 2.8 million likes in just 3 hours. However, Taylor disabled comments, allowing her to see more detailed feedback from her audience.

After concluding her European tour, Taylor will take two months off before continuing her tour in Miami, USA, on October 18th. The pop superstar's final stop will be Vancouver, Canada, in December.
